Subject: Vextrel licensing spat — quick update

Hi all,

Quick heads-up for finance: Vextrel Systems is disputing our right to bundle their Corespan module with the Harlow release. Their counsel says our 2022 agreement covers internal use only. Marnie's team thinks we're on solid ground, but there's a real chance we'll need to escrow roughly a quarter's worth of royalties while this shakes out. Please hold off on the Q3 royalty reconciliation until we confirm. Relevant strategic context follows below.

internal memo for kaduf-baduf: Only 35 of the 378 pilot accounts renewed Holir, so a churn review is set for June 11. Eliielax Group is in early talks to buy Silaelix Group for about $142.1 million.

Vendor note for the release manager: Tickwright, our scheduling vendor, has acknowledged the cron drift affecting the Harrowfield batch jobs. Their analysis points to clock skew on two of their executor hosts rather than our job definitions, so no release action is required yet. They expect a patched executor image within two weeks. Until then, hold any changes to the batch window. Direct follow-up questions to their support contact below.

escalation mailbox, hadug-bajog: sormir@norvalabs.internal

Subject: On-call heads-up — Orchardly catalog cache. Welcome aboard. The main gotcha: catalog price updates invalidate by SKU, but bundle pages cache composite keys, so a stale bundle can outlive its parts. If support reports wrong bundle prices, purge the composite namespace first. We'll cover this at the weekly sync; the invalidation playbook is on this internal page.

wiki page, yagef-tawif: https://sentry.lumicdata.local/view/merge_requests/pipeline/merge_requests/e08f7f35c80b5755